726. Saved by Grace

1 Some day the silver cord will break,
And I no more as now shall sing;
But oh, the joy when I shall wake
Within the palace of the King!

Refrain:
And I shall see him face to face,
And tell the story - Saved by grace;
And I shall see him face to face,
And tell the story - Saved by grace.

2 Some day my earthly house will fall,
I cannot tell how soon 'twill be;
But this I know - my All in All
Has now a place in heav'n for me. [Refrain]

3 Some day, when fades the golden sun
Beneath the rosy-tinted west,
My blessed Lord will say, "Well done!"
And I shall enter into rest. [Refrain]

4. Some day: till then I'll watch and wait,
My lamp all trimmed and burning bright,
That when my Saviour opes the gate,
My soul to him may take its flight. [Refrain]

Amen.

Text Information
First Line: Some day the silver cord will break
Title: Saved by Grace
Author: Fanny J. Crosby (1893)
Refrain First Line: And I shall see him face to face
Language: English
Publication Date: 1961
Scripture:
Topic: Hymns for Informal Occasions; Life; Longing for Christ and God (3 more...)
Tune Information
Name: [Some day the silver cord will break]
Composer: George C. Stebbins (1893)
Arranger: Seymour Swets
Key: F Major
